9/23/2010 - Patrick - winereviewer.com.au wrote: 90 Points
Drying plum and on the nose, with dark fruits on the palate with soft, supple tannins. This wine is moving towards the more savoury specturm, so those who are expecting typical Wolf Blass primary fruit and oak influence should drink now.
Review Link - www.winereviewer.com.au (drink by 2011)
